Those familiar with the "Hataraki Man" manga or drama series know that the term "hataraki man" refers to the story's protagonist, a woman who has sacrificed her private life to devote herself to her work.

Research firm Oricon decided to see which celebrities best fit that image. 900 people were asked, "Which female celebrity do you think of as a 'hataraki man?'" Actress Miho Kanno was not allowed as an answer, since she stars in the drama series.

Ryoko Shinohara ranked first, having built a strong image as a working woman through dramas such as "Haken no Hinkaku" and "Anego." Masami Hisamoto was #2, due to her ubiquitous presence on variety shows.

The other top answers were Yuki Amami, Yukie Nakama, Makiko Esumi, Masami Nagasawa, Hitomi Kuroki, Norika Fujiwara, announcer Aya Takashima (tied with Fujiwara), Yui Aragaki, and newscaster Yuko Ando (tied with Aragaki).
